Brooks Bridge construction brings nighttime lane reductions to Okaloosa Island

Crews will narrow traffic to one lane in each direction overnight as construction continues on the $171 million Brooks Bridge Replacement Project.

Drivers crossing Okaloosa Island should expect nighttime lane reductions on Highway 98 this week as crews work to build the new westbound Brooks Bridge structure.

  • Beginning the week of Sunday, Aug. 9, the travel lanes on U.S. 98 between Santa Rosa Boulevard and the pedestrian overpass will be reduced to a single lane in each direction from 9 p.m. to 5:30 a.m., according to the Florida Department of Transportation.

The configuration is designed to give crews the space needed to construct the new westbound bridge.

FDOT also noted that intermittent lane closures on U.S. 98 from Ferry Road to Pier Road may occur between 9 p.m. and 5:30 a.m. Sunday through Thursday.

The work is part of the $171 million Brooks Bridge Replacement Project, which calls for constructing two new parallel bridges that will increase capacity to six travel lanes. The current four-lane bridge opened in 1966. The project is estimated to be completed by summer 2027.
